How Do Development Agreements Turn Data Center Conditions Into Executable Obligations?

Entitlement conditions and infrastructure commitments become real project risk when they are vague about scope, timing, payment, acceptance, ownership, reimbursement, or remedies. Development agreements should convert promises into executable obligations.

Coordinate public and private approvals

The highest-consequence failure modes include open-ended 'developer shall improve' language, payment due before approvals or access, reimbursement terms with no timing, conflicting standards between agencies, and commitments lost between entitlement and construction. Separate these from ordinary design development. A red flag belongs in the executive risk register when it can materially change deliverable capacity, approval probability, schedule, capital exposure, operations, or the ability to exit the transaction.

Protect changes, delays, and third-party dependencies

Real sites rarely optimize every variable at once. Typical trade-offs include greater certainty versus negotiation time, fixed scope versus future flexibility, front-loaded funding versus milestone payments, and public acceptance versus private control. Compare alternatives against the same capacity, date, cost, and risk basis. A mitigation that solves one discipline but creates a larger entitlement, utility, construction, or operating problem is not a complete solution.
